What is Ecommerce Marketing?
Ecommerce marketing is the process of endorsing and selling products or services through digital platforms, like websites, social media, or email marketing. These activities are important for online stores since they help them reach their target audience, generate website traffic, increase sales, and finally generate revenue.

Stages of Ecommerce Marketing Strategy
Stage 1: Attracting Visitors
The first stage in an ecommerce marketing strategy is to attract customers to the website. This can be done through different methods such as paid advertising, social media marketing, content marketing, and search engine optimization. Here, customers are generally in the awareness stage of the sales funnel. This means they are just learning about the company and products.
Stage 2: Driving Conversion
In this stage, customers are influenced to take action. This may include purchasing a product, signing up for a newsletter, or submitting a contact form. The stage meets the consideration and decision stages of the sales funnel, where consumers examine different options and then make a buying decision.
Step 3: Establishing Existing Relationships
Lastly, it is crucial to continue managing relationships with the customers even after the sale. This could be possible with email marketing, social media, and other platforms. The purpose is to keep the brand in customers’ minds and influence repeated purchases. This stage meets the loyalty of the sales funnel, where customers support the brand and are likely to recommend the products to others.

Effective Ecommerce Marketing Strategies
Let’s discuss some of the best ecommerce marketing strategies that can help you generate traffic, build loyalty, and repeat business.
- First is to improve the SEO of your ecommerce website to drive more traffic. When an ecommerce store ranks higher on the search engine results pages, potential customers probably find it first. The striking fact of online marketing is that you can attract customers who are actively looking for particular products through search engines. Hence, by improving your SEO, you can drive more traffic and sales.
- Marketers can use on-site marketing tools to drive engagement. Some of the common tools are popups, notification feed, or interactive landing pages that actually work for engaging visitors and boosting conversion rates. They help in displaying the products, endorsing special offers, and gathering email addresses for future marketing campaigns.
- It is also useful to establish a strong social media presence to stay connected with customers. Reportedly, 78% of the customers in the US find new products via social media platforms. Hence, with a strong social media presence, you can drive traffic to the ecommerce site and engage with your audience.
- Targeted emails are potential ways to promote special offers. Email marketing is indeed a cost-effective way to promote your ecommerce site and influence repeat purchases. The best way is to segment the email lists and send targeted emails to particular groups of subscribers and customers.
- Marketers can make the business mobile-optimized to improve user experience. As reported by Statista, mobile devices drive 60% of the global traffic in 2022. This means the website needs to be responsive and easy to use on mobile devices to ensure a smooth mobile user experience.
- Driving traffic with paid advertising tools can also help marketers. Paid advertising tools like Google Ads and Facebook Ads can be used for strong targeting. It suggests that you can target specific audiences based on interests, demographics, and behaviour.
- You can create valuable content to engage visitors and drive traffic. Blogs, videos, and infographics often attract customers. By sharing favourable content and insights about the products or services, you can position yourself as a trusted brand.
- Next is to collaborate with affiliates and influencers to expand the target audience. Affiliates are the people or companies who endorse your products on their sites or social media platforms for a commission. While, influencers are those who have a large following list on social media and can promote your products to the right audience.
